    Coinbase CEO Says Company Won’t Pay Hackers’ Ransom

    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ong mentioned in a social media post Thursday {that a} ransom word arrived through e mail asking for $20 million in Bitcoin in trade for not releasing info hackers had obtained on Coinbase’s clients.

    “I’ll reply publicly,” Armstrong mentioned. “We aren’t going to pay ransom.”

    Armstrong mentioned attackers had discovered a “weak hyperlink” customer support agent exterior the U.S. who accepted a “bribe” and gave away private knowledge on clients.

    In an organization blog post, Coinbase mentioned it’s going to reimburse clients tricked into sending funds to the attacker. Hackers acquired entry to names, addresses, telephone numbers, and emails; masked Social Safety numbers (final 4 digits solely); masked financial institution‑account numbers; and authorities‑ID pictures (driver’s licenses, passports). No passwords or non-public keys had been obtained, the corporate says. The e-mail arrived on Sunday.

    “(The stolen knowledge) permits them to conduct social engineering assaults the place they’ll name our clients impersonating Coinbase buyer assist and attempt to trick them into sending their funds to the attackers,” Armstrong mentioned.

    Per the AP, Coinbase estimated in a filing with the SEC that it might find yourself spending wherever between $180 million and $400 million “regarding remediation prices and voluntary buyer reimbursements regarding this incident.”

    In the meantime, the New York Times reports that the SEC is individually investigating Coinbase over whether or not or not it reported inaccurate numbers throughout its IPO in 2021. The corporate claimed to have greater than 100 million “verified customers” in advertising supplies.

    Coinbase’s inventory dropped 7% on Thursday after the information, per Yahoo.
